Caring For Your Range
Continued
16
Personal Injury Hazard
) Allow surface unit and sur-
rounding areas to reduce in
temperature from hot to warm
before removing heavy or
sugary spills. Wear protective
clothing such as oven mitts.
) Do not use cooktop cleaner on
a hot cooktop. The cleaner may
produce hazardous fumes or
damage the cooktop.
D Do not use the range if the
cooktop is cracked or broken.
Failure to follow these instruc-
tions can result in personal injury.
To avoid damaging the cooktop,
follow these instructions:
b Make sure bottoms of pans are
clean and dry before using.
m Avoid spill-overs. Use pans with
tall sides.
* Do not allow anything that may
melt (plastic, aluminum foil,
sugar or food with high sugar
content) to come in contact with
the surface while it is hot.
l
Do not use the cooktop as a
cutting board.
l
Do not place food directly on
ceramic cooktop.
. Do not use steel wool, plastic
cleaning pads, abrasive
powdered cleansers, chlorine
bleach, rust remover, ammonia,
glass cleaning products with
ammonia or cleaning products
designed for white ceramic
cooktops. These could damage
the cooktop surface.
l
Dropping heavy or hard objects
on the cooktop can crack it. Be
careful with heavy skillets. Don’1
store jars or cans above the
COOktOp.
Cleaning tips
l
Light soils - Remove with a clean,
damp paper towel.
l
Greasy soils - Remove with a
soapy sponge or soft cloth -OR- with
vinegar and a clean paper towel.
Rinse and dry well.
l
Stubborn soils-Apply a vinegar
soaked paper towel to the stain for
lo-15 minutes. Rub off soil. Rinse and
dry well.
l
Heavy soils - Carefully scrape
heavy spills using a single edge razor
blade in a holder. Remove remaining
residue with a non-abrasive cleanser
and a clean, damp paper towel. Rinse
and dry well.
l
Sugary spills and soils-To avoid
pitting on the cooktop, clean spills up
while the glass is still warm. Fol-
low cleaning instructions for “Heavy
soils” above. Rinse and dry well.
NOTE: Always rinse and dry your cook-
top thoroughly after cleaning. This will
prevent streaking or staining from
cleaning materials.
l
Tiny scratches or abrasions are not
removable, but do not affect cooking.
In time, the scratches will become
less visible as a result of cleaning.
l
For further care of your cooktop, use
the Cooktop Polishing Creme in-
cluded with your range. Use only on
a clean, cool cooktop. Follow instruc-
tions on the container to remove metal
marks (from copper or aluminum
pans) as soon as possible. If heated,
metal marks may not come off. Cook-
top Polishing Creme will also remove
dark streaks, specks and discolora-
tions caused by cleaning materials or
foods.
